On the inside of the forearm are the flexor muscles that allow you to grab something with your hand. On the other side of the forearm are the stretching muscles that stretch the hand again.
Tendons run from those muscles to your fingers as 'strings'. When the flexors contract, they flex your fingers through the tendons. In order for these tendons to slide smoothly, they run through a kind of tubes that are filled with lubricant. We call these tubes sheaths.
